This sense of family extends from the immediate family to relatives, workers and visitors. Wine travelers who meet family members will immediately sense the strong family attachment. Some of the grapes are pressed at this site and there are several tanks in the barrel room.Īlthough the Vezér Ranch is a private residence, there are over 15 acres of vineyards, a private tasting room for wine club members and a wonderful venue for weddings. Behind the Blue Victorian is a barrel room and surrounding the buildings are 13 acres of grapevines. Just a mile away the Blue Victorian, a restored 100 year-old house, serves as a tasting room and has two rental suites. ![]() At the Mankas Corner Tasting Room location, there is a tasting room, deli, beautiful garden, outdoor event area, barrel room and apartment for rent.
